Cygames, the Japanese game development company, has been keeping its fans on the edge of their seats with the progress of three highly anticipated titles: Project Awakening, Lost Order, and Garnet Arena: Mages of Magicary. In an interview with Weekly Famitsu, Cygames President Koichi Watanabe provided some much-needed updates on the development status of these games, offering a glimpse into the future of the gaming industry.
Project Awakening, an action RPG that was first announced in 2016, has been a long-awaited title for many players. Watanabe revealed that the game is 'really starting to take shape' and that the team is working with a sense of confidence. The game's development has been a rollercoaster, with a demo released in 2019 and new footage showcased at the Cygames Tech Conference in 2021. Despite the lack of recent updates, Watanabe assured fans that the game is steadily progressing and that the team is adding new elements to enhance the overall experience.
Lost Order, a real-time tactics game announced in 2016, is also in the final stretch of development. Watanabe described the game's quality as 'astonishing' and 'unbelievable for a smartphone app.' The game has undergone a complete rebuild, including character models, and the team is confident that the quality will continue to improve. The development process has been a challenging one, but Watanabe believes that the end result will be worth the wait.
Garnet Arena: Mages of Magicary, a fantasy action game produced by Kenichiro Takaki, is another major title in the works. Watanabe hinted at the game's unique nature and suggested that it will be unlike any of Cygames' previous titles. While he couldn't share specific details, he assured fans that the game is moving forward and that an announcement is on the horizon.
Watanabe also touched on the company's larger-scale projects, mentioning that Cygames has been taking on 'fairly new' gameplay challenges. The company's priority remains to complete the titles announced at Cygames NEXT 2016, but they are also preparing additional new projects. These smaller-scale titles are designed to expand the company's lineup and provide opportunities for younger creators to gain experience.
